With help from a group of Environmental Studies students, UM Dining started Farm to College in 2003 a local procurement program designed to bring more responsibly raised and grown Montana products to campus. This policy ensures that the university recovers and recycles refrigerants which are known ozone-depleting substances (ODS) during servicing and disposal of refrigeration and air-conditioning equipment, as required by the EPA's Clean Air Act. That's one of the conclusions from a new environmental justice study by researchers at the University of Michigan and the University of Montana who analyzed 30 years of demographic data about the placement of U.S. hazardous waste facilities.
